The Intricacies of Video Narration: A Critique of the Veo3 “We’re All Prompts” Trend
It seems that a growing number of people share a common sentiment regarding the recent surge in Veo3 videos labeled as “We’re All Prompts.” While these videos are garnering attention, many viewers find them to be lacking in substance and depth.
One of the critical issues lies in the interpretation of the term “prompt.” The narration often suggests that we, as individuals, are analogous to prompts, echoing a theory that appears to oversimplify the concept. In reality, prompts serve as inputs—cues or stimuli that elicit responses—rather than outputs, which are the results or actions derived from those cues. This fundamental misunderstanding raises questions about the creators’ grasp of the subject matter.
